WebRisk Description: Repetitive use of power tools when blowing and placing insulation into walls, ceilings and thermal controlled areas and equipment exposes workers to hand … WebVibration transmitted from a tool or piece of equipment can affect the blood vessels, nerves, muscles and joints in the fingers, hand and arm. The collection of symptoms is called hand-arm vibration syndrome (HAVS). Symptoms include one or more of the following: • Intermittent periods of numbness in the fingers (with or without tingling)
